Top 5 Wuxia Games Performance in Kenya - Q2 2023
In Q2 2023, the top 5 Wuxia games in Kenya show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at their metrics.
In Q2 2023, the top 5 Wuxia games on a unified platform in Kenya displayed diverse performance trends. Below is an overview of their weekly downloads, revenue, and active users, as provided by Sensor Tower.
Yong Heroes by Watt Games experienced f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at around $247 in mid-April. The game saw a notable increase in weekly downloads, reaching 132 in the last week of June. The active user base also grew steadily, peaking at 115 users in the final week of June.
Crasher: Nirvana showed a significant increase in weekly revenue, reaching $134 in mid-June. However, the game’s weekly downloads saw a decline, dropping to zero in the latter part of the quarter.
Immortal Taoists-idle Games from Singapore Azure Times PTE.LTD had a consistent revenue stream, peaking at $33 in the final week of June. The game maintained a stable download trend, with a peak of 395 in mid-April. The active user count remained robust, reaching 627 by the end of June.
Ode To Heroes by DHGames Limited showed minimal revenue activity and no significant downloads or active user data throughout the quarter.
Lastly, 想不想修真-官方版 by Walk Gaming had negligible revenue, downloads, and active user data, indicating limited engagement in the Kenyan market during Q2 2023.
